What a gas engineer covers beyond the boiler
Most people only think about Gas Safe registration when the boiler stops. In practice a lot of the work across Washington is everything else: a fire that will not light, a cooker being connected, a landlord certificate falling due, or a smell of gas that needs someone out.
Gas fires and heaters
Gas fires need servicing as much as boilers do and get it far less often. The checks that matter are the flue, the oxygen depletion safety device and the combustion, and those are exactly what nobody does when a fire is simply lit each winter and forgotten. A fire in an unswept chimney or with a blocked flue is one of the genuinely dangerous things in a house.
Cookers and hobs
Connecting or disconnecting a gas cooker is Gas Safe work, not a job for a delivery driver, and it includes checking the connection, the stability bracket and the surrounding ventilation. It is a small job that people regularly get wrong.
Landlord gas safety certificates
If you let property in Washington you need a gas safety record every twelve months covering every gas appliance and flue. Given how much of the new town housing is rented, that is a lot of certificates. We issue the record on the day and can put multiple properties on one schedule so they do not expire one at a time.
Suspected gas leaks
If you can smell gas, the first call is the National Gas Emergency Service on 0800 111 999, not us. They will make the supply safe. What they do not do is repair your pipework or appliance, and that is where we pick it up, tracing the leak and putting it right so the supply can be restored.
The Washington specific bit
Housing here went up in phases, so whole districts share an age and a way of being plumbed. That matters for gas work as well as heating: pipe runs are fairly predictable, and on older phases the existing gas supply pipe is sometimes undersized for a modern appliance. That is checkable with a working pressure test, and it is far better established before you buy a new cooker or boiler than after.
